ELECTRODE SHARPENING
For optimal operation, it is recommended to use a sharpened electrode as follows:
d
L
L = 3 x d for a low current.
L = d for a high current
SAVE AND LOAD WELDING SETTINGS
Saved settings: 10 in MMA mode and 10 in TIG DC mode.
The menu is accessed by pressing the
button.
Saving a configuration
Once in programme mode, select IN and press the access button.
Slect a program from P1 to P10. Press the access button and the current setting is saved.
Load an existing setting
Once in program mode, select OUT and press the access button.
Slect a program from P1 to P10. Press the access button and the setting is loaded.
